After merging the scsi tree, today's linux-next build (x86_64
allmodconfig) failed like this:

drivers/scsi/qedi/qedi_main.c: In function 'qedi_init':
drivers/scsi/qedi/qedi_main.c:2073:2: error: implicit declaration of function 
'register_hotcpu_notifier' [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
  register_hotcpu_notifier(&qedi_cpu_notifier);
  ^
drivers/scsi/qedi/qedi_main.c: In function 'qedi_cleanup':
drivers/scsi/qedi/qedi_main.c:2113:2: error: implicit declaration of function 
'unregister_hotcpu_notifier' [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
  unregister_hotcpu_notifier(&qedi_cpu_notifier);
  ^

Caused by commit

  ace7f46ba5fd ("scsi: qedi: Add QLogic FastLinQ offload iSCSI driver 
framework.")

Interacting with commit

  8e38db753d95 ("cpu/hotplug: Remove obsolete cpu hotplug register/unregister 
functions")

from the tip tree.
